Zinsser Analytic highlights benefits of new FISH-LISSY system

18th December 2012

Zinsser Analytic has detailed the benefits its collaboratively-developed FISH-LISSY systems can offer in the diagnosis of leukaemia and other health conditions

Fluorescence in situ hybridisation (FISH) technology functions by using samples of blood or bone marrow in a short-term cell culture to receive cells in the metaphase status, which are then investigated via microscope to determine the cell coordinates with metaphase chromosomes.

In association with a major diagnostic laboratory, Zinsser Analytic has developed a system for automating the precise transfer of FISH-probes to predefined coordinates, with the samples subsequently being covered with slides.

Because this process is entirely standardised, sources of potential errors are minimised, while the modular nature of the FISH-LISSY systems mean they can be customised to any laboratory environment.

This will help lab technicians that are using FISH technology to try and determine which for of leukaemia is affecting patients.

Zinsser Analytic was originally founded in 1970 and operates offices in the UK, Germany, France and the US, as well as a global network of distributors.ADNFCR-8000103-ID-801508934-ADNFCR
